Output af2acee621c399be934d0b181e396ff74ec31de5d18b987968fe4f2aa659d06e:1

value
708663379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fbd6105faeef1fb65e1ad355dda845d442f328 OP_EQUAL
address
3NvvNw6S9ELGyjB6yLZ2e7Bzj1iPhQVFX2
transaction
af2acee621c399be934d0b181e396ff74ec31de5d18b987968fe4f2aa659d06e
spent
true